As a California worker, you enjoy many legal protections. You are entitled to receive fair pay for the labor that you perform, including overtime when appropriate. You are entitled to meal and rest breaks. Your job should be properly classified as exempt or hourly, and you should be compensated accordingly. If you believe that your rights are being violated, we advise you to talk to an attorney and explore legal remedies that may be available to you.

Unfortunately, many employers ignore the law when it comes to dealing with their employees. Likewise, many employees are ignorant of their rights. Employment law is there to protect us, but without vigilance and action, rights may be violated.

Workers often sense that something is wrong in the workplace, particularly if they are being subjected to sexual harassment or passed over for promotions and raises, apparently due to discrimination on the basis of national origin, race, religion, age or gender. A discussion with a knowledgeable employment law attorney is a step in the right direction toward resolving a work-related dispute.
